Garth Brooks sues woman over sexual assault allegations claiming emotional distress
Garth Brooks has filed a lawsuit against a woman who accused him of sexual assault, claiming her allegations caused him emotional distress. The woman, identified as Jane Roe, alleged that Brooks assaulted her in 2019 and made inappropriate comments while she worked for him. Brooks denied the allegations and labeled the lawsuit as extortion. He is seeking damages for emotional distress, defamation, and invasion of privacy, as well as punitive damages. He previously filed a separate lawsuit to stop what he called false allegations against him. The woman’s lawyers expressed support for her decision to come forward, stating that sexual predators exist in all areas, including country music. Brooks has stated he trusts the legal system and maintains his innocence.
